PHP作为一种开源的脚本语言,广泛应用于互联网行业中。它的使用非常灵活,PHP配置文件可以方便地进行修改,使程序员可以自由地添加、删除和修改代码来实现程序的功能。在PHP应用程序中,数据库密码是一个重要的部分,为了保证安全性,密码不能泄露。本篇文章将简要介绍如何修改PHP配置文件中的数据库密码。
一、打开PHP配置文件
打开PHP的配置文件是修改密码的前提。在不同的操作系统上,配置文件的路径可能会有所不同。常见的路径如下:
打开PHP的配置文件并进行编辑。
二、定位到MySQL配置
在配置文件中,MySQL是PHP应用程序中最常用的数据库之一。为了修改MySQL密码,我们需要进入MySQL配置的区域,将MySQL密码设置为新密码。在PHP的配置文件中,MySQL配置文件路径可能有所不同,但通常可以使用以下命令来查找MySQL的位置:
grep -r 'mysql.default_socket' /etc/php*
该命令可以查找PHP配置文件中MySQL的路径。接下来,我们需要在配置文件中寻找MySQL配置的标识,可能的标识如下:
[MySQL] [mysqli] [pdo_mysql]
这些标识是向PHP告诉它如何连接MySQL的指令集。我们可以找到这些标识,进入到这些标识的区域,并修改其中的密码项,使其与新密码匹配。
三、编辑MySQL配置信息
进入MySQL配置的区域之后,我们需要编辑其中的密码项。MySQL密码保存在PHP的配置文件中,并且需要进行编码。在修改密码之前,需要清楚地知道密码编码的类型。MySQL密码通常使用MD5加密,但也有其他类型的加密方式。确保你知道密码的加密方式,以便正确地更新密码。
接下来,我们需要在MySQL配置中找到密码的标识,并修改密码的值。
在[MySQL]中,密码配置项可以像下面这样看到:
;password = your_password
去掉前面的';'注释,把旧密码后跟着的';'注释掉,然后在 '=' 号后面插入新密码,如下所示:
password = new_password
在[mysqli]中,密码可以像这样看到:
mysqli.default_pw = your_password
把旧密码后跟着的';'注释掉,并在 '=' 号后面插入新密码,如下所示:
mysqli.default_pw = new_password
在[pdo_mysql]中,密码配置项可以像这样看到:
pdo_mysql.default_password = your_password
把旧密码后跟着的';'注释掉,然后在 '=' 号后面插入新密码,如下所示:
pdo_mysql.default_password = new_password
四、保存并退出
当你更新密码之后,保存配置文件并退出。您的更改应该现在生效。
在本篇文章中,我们讨论了如何在PHP配置文件中修改MySQL密码。这个过程涉及到打开配置文件,定位到MySQL配置区域,编辑MySQL配置信息,保存并退出。MySQL密码是PHP应用程序的重要部分,因此,当安全问题导致密码泄露时,修改密码是至关重要的。
以上是详解php怎么通过配置文件来修改密码的详细内容。更多信息请关注PHP中文网其他相关文章!